Upload Photos & Get Quote →Maspeth sits at western Queens's industrial spine — bordered by Long Island City (north), Middle Village (south), Woodside (east), and the Brooklyn line / Newtown Creek (west). The neighborhood splits into two operationally distinct zones. The industrial zone along Grand Avenue, 58th Street, and the Maspeth Plateau hosts warehouses, distribution centers, contractor yards, and small manufacturers — substantial commercial cleanout work. The residential blocks south of Grand Avenue are predominantly attached 1920s-40s two-family brick homes with side driveways.
Demographically Maspeth has been a Polish-American working-class community for decades, with substantial Polish-owned businesses on Grand Avenue. Newer Latino and Asian arrivals have grown over the last 15 years. Polish-speaking crew on request.
Operationally Maspeth is one of the easiest Queens neighborhoods to work — direct BQE and LIE access, broad streets, and side-driveway loading for residential.
